Leigh and Atherton MP – Jo Platt – has become a Dementia Research Champion – and she will work with Alzheimer’s Research UK – the charity which is seeking to find a cure to the neurodegenerative disease. 

There are currently 1,422 the people in Leigh and Atherton living with dementia.

Jo Platt says: “I’m proud to be a Dementia Research Champion, working with Alzheimer’s Research UK and I am committed to standing up for the people in Leigh and Atherton that are living with dementia and supporting vital research for a cure.

“Dementia is currently the leading cause of death in the UK. Without urgent action, one in two people will be directly impacted – whether by developing the condition, caring for someone who has it, or both.

“As a Dementia Research Champion, I proudly stand with Alzheimer’s Research UK to advocate for earlier diagnosis, improved treatments, and greater investment in research to transform the future of dementia in the UK.”
